Latest Non-Redemption Agreements: Fusion Acquisition Corp. II


Fusion Acquisition Corp. II (FSNB) Adds Non-Redemption Agreement

On August 25, Fusion Acquisition Corp. II (NYSE:FSNB) and Fusion Sponsor II LLC entered into a non-redemption agreement with an unaffiliated third-party investor, pursuant to which the investor has agreed not to redeem, or to reverse and revoke any prior redemption election with respect to 220,000 shares of Class A common stock.

Pursuant to the agreement, the sponsor has agreed to transfer to the investor 55,500 shares of Class B common stock in connection with the consummation of the business combination.

The company and the sponsor may enter into similar, additional non-redemption agreements with other parties in connection with the extension meeting. The agreements are not expected to increase the likelihood that the extension is approved by stockholders at the meeting but will increase the amount of funds that remain in the company’s trust account.
